SPX385AM-L-2-5/TR Overview
A handy package called TO-236-3, SC-59, SOT-23-3 is used.It is used as a voltage reference and is controlled by Shunt.The handy Tape & Reel (TR) variable is used in this program.The 3 terminations have a variety of functions.A precise voltage reference must have a tolerance of ±1%.The reference voltage is coupled to an analog IC TWO TERMINAL VOLTAGE REFERENCE.On the basis of the test statistics, 2.5V voltage is output.The output of 1 is sufficient.Input is taken from a Fixed form.Temperatures should not rise above 260 during reflow soldering.For PCB designs that require high precision, Surface Mount is available.Working within -40°C~85°C TA is my area of expertise.20mA input applications can use the reference voltage.Generally, the cathode current should be 20μA.The voltage generated is fixed/minimum at 2.5V.A voltage reference circuit's maximum voltage output is tested 2.525V.This voltage reference ic outputs a voltage of at least 2.475V.
